Typical Causes of Broken Window Handles


Window handles can break for a variety of reasons. Understanding these causes is the primary step towards avoidance.

Trigger

Description

Use and Tear

In time, consistent usage can cause deterioration of the materials, leading to a malfunctioning handle.

Environmental Factors

Extreme weather, like humidity or freezing temperatures, can compromise materials and trigger damage.

Poor Installation

Inaccurate installation can result in undue stress on the handle, making it more vulnerable to breaking.

Accidental Damage

Knocking the window shut or utilizing excessive force to open it can easily break a handle.

Rust and Corrosion

Metal manages can wear away in time, particularly in seaside areas, resulting in a weakened structure.

Preventative Measures


Avoiding future issues with window deals with can save time, money, and inconvenience. Here are some pointers to maintain window deals with:

  1. Regular Maintenance:

    • Inspect manages for signs of wear or rust periodically.
    • Tidy manages with a wet cloth to prevent dirt accumulation.
  2. Oil Hinges:

    • Apply lubricant to mechanisms every 6-12 months to ensure smooth operation.
  3. Avoid Excessive Force:

    • Always run windows carefully to decrease the threat of breaking a handle.
  4. Choose Durable Materials:

    • When changing window manages, go with those made from top quality, long lasting products fit for your environment.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)


Q1: How do I understand if my window handle needs to be changed?

A: If the handle is broken, shaky, or unable to run the window properly, it likely requirements replacement.

Q2: Can I replace a window handle myself?

A: Yes, if you are comfy using standard tools and have identified the appropriate replacement handle.

Q3: How much does it cost to replace a window handle?

A: Replacement costs can differ widely based upon the handle type and labor expenses, typically varying from ₤ 10 to ₤ 100 for parts and installation.

Q4: Is it essential to call an expert for repairs?

A: If you doubt about the repair process or if there are more considerable concerns with the window, calling a professional is suggested.

Q5: How can I prevent rust on metal manages?

A: Regular cleansing and application of a protective spray can help prevent rust formation, specifically in coastal locations.
